AI Summary: The Law Enforcement Suicide Data Collection Act is a federal bill aimed at improving the collection of data on law enforcement suicides. The main provisions of the bill include requiring the FBI to collect and publish data on law enforcement suicides, providing grants to states for mental health services for law enforcement officers, and establishing a task force to study the causes of law enforcement suicides. This bill seeks to address mental health issues among law enforcement officers and provide support to reduce the incidence of suicide within this community.
